MySQL查询表数据详解:基础与高级技巧

创始人
2025-03-11 04:33:15
0 次浏览
0 评论

mysql如何查询表中所有的字段?

查询所有字段都是查询表中的所有数据。
可以使用MySQL的Select语句来实现此操作。
基本语法是:选择字段名称表名称。
如果查询结果中的字段顺序与表中的字段不一致,则结果将显示在指定的字段顺序中。
如果表中有许多字段,并且指定的字段更复杂且容易出错,则可以使用通配符“*”而不是所有字段名称来简化SQL语句的写入。
语法格式为:选择*表名。
使用“*”查询Stu表中的所有数据。
结果的顺序必须与表中的字段一致,并且不能自定义。
接下来,我们介绍如何指定字段以查询数据。
使用Select语句时,您可以通过列出字段名称来查询表中特定字段的数据。
在满足复杂的业务需求时,可能需要分类,分组和分页查询结果等高级操作。
MySQL提供了用于分类的订单关键字。
特定的语法格式为:选择字段名称表名称orderby字段名称ASC/DESC; ASC代表上升顺序和DESC代表下降顺序。
在统计过程中,MySQL提供聚集功能,例如count(sum(),sum(),avg(),max(),min(),min()等。
计数()函数用于计算特定列的行数或特定列的行数,Sum()函数用于计算指定列函数的最大值,AVG()函数的最大值是计算列的平均值,该函数的最大值是计算柱子的最大值,该函数是计算的。
指定的列和min()函数用于计算指定列的最小值。
IFNULL()函数用于确定字段是否为null,并在值0为null时替换为0。
查询数据分组时,您可以使用GroupBy关键字来执行分组查询。
例如,在学生表中通过性别分组的查询数据,或查询员工表中按部门编号分组的工资总和。
分组查询后,可以过滤数据。
MySQL提供了一个具有子句以在分组后过滤数据。
语法格式为:选择字段名称,表名,groupby字段名称,具有条件。
为了优化查询性能,MySQL提供了限制关键字以限制查询结果的数量并实现分页效应。
限制之后可以是两个参数:m是起始索引,默认值为0,n是从m+1 记录中获取的记录数。
通过使用上述MySQL高级查询功能,可以有效地处理各种复杂的数据查询需求。

MySQL查询表数据方法详解MySQL下怎么查表数据

解释MySQL MySQL查询表的详细数据方法是目前是世界上使用最广泛的关系数据库管理系统。
使用MySQL时,查询表数据是非常基本且必不可少的活动。
1 选择mySQL的基本查询语句的基本查询语句,其语法如下:selectfield1 ,field2 ,... forttable_namewherecondition; 例如,要查询具有“用户”表的表中的所有数据,您可以使用以下命令:选择*Frofuser; 2 复杂的查询语句除了基本的查询语句外,MySQL还提供了复杂的查询语句以满足不同的查询需求。
1 限制查询结果的数量。
例如,要查询带有名称“用户”的表中的前1 0个数据部分,您可以使用以下命令:选择*FromUserLimit1 0; 2 安排查询结果。
例如,要查询具有“用户”表的表格中的所有数据并按照“年龄”字段逐渐减小的顺序排列,您可以使用以下命令:select*frofuseRorderByageDescc; 3 组查询结果。
例如,要查询使用“用户”和IT组“性别”的表中的所有数据,您可以使用以下命令:selectGhder,计数(*)FrofUserGroupGroupGroupGergerder; 4 连接查询表数据。
例如,要查询具有名称“用户”和“订单”表的数据并进行“ user_id”连接查询,您可以使用以下命令:选择*frof userjoinorderoser.id = order = order.user_id; 3 .执行以下实际情况是一个实际情况。
现在,您需要查询学生的信息和班级名称。
您可以使用以下命令:selectstudents.id,student。
在课堂“班级”和“参与”中编写学校名称,执行连接查询操作,并使用“ student.class_id = class.id”连接两个表。
4 . MySQL查询数据表是MySQL开发过程中开发人员的非常基本和必要的活动。

怎么查看mysql数据库中所有表名

请求MySQL数据库中的所有表格:select of Invoryation_schema.tables的表_name,where table_schema ='当前数据库名称'andtable_type ='baseTable'; 姓名 '; ; 请求指定数据库中的所有表Selecttable_namefrominformation_schema.tableswhere_schema ='database_name'anme'andtable_type ='baseTable'; 在表上的所有字段和类型的字段='table_name'的所有字段和类型上,请求所有字段名称;

如何查询数据库中表的字段名

根据以下语句,询问数据库中表的字段名称:1 _schema.TableSeect* from InuminFormation_schema.schema.viewsseect* from Inominform_schema.columns.columns3 ,oracle oracle 访问所有表名称:扩展信息:其他使用扩展:使用视图查看服务器上的数据库:mySQL> showdatabases; SQL> ShowTables; EatetableMytable(nameVarchar(2 0),SexChaar(1 )); XT“ intotablemytable;
文章标签:
MySQL 查询
热门文章
1
高效掌握:CMD命令轻松启动、关闭及登录... 如何用cmd命令快速启动和关闭mysql数据库服务开发中经常使用MySQL数据库...

2
MySQL分区删除技巧与8.0版本新特性... mysql删除分区在MySQL中,删除分区操作主要使用“可替代”的命令与“ dr...

3
Python代码实现:如何判断三角形的三... python三角形三条边长,判断能否构成三角形Python三角形的三个长边如下:...

4
深度解析:MySQL查询语句执行顺序及优... mysql查询语句执行顺序当这是由于执行SQL的过程时,了解其过程很重要。 ...

5
SQL教程:使用SUBSTRING和IN... sql取特定字符的前面几位字符selectsubstr('L-0FCLDRBCT...

6
MySQL日期差异计算方法:轻松获取日期... MySQL计算时间差两日期相减得月份mysql两时间相减得月MySQL计算时间之...

7
MySQL及SQL查询获取前10条数据方... MySql查询前10条数据sql语句是从MySQL获取前1 0个数据的SQL查询...

8
MySQL启动问题排查与解决指南 Mysql为什么启动不了如果要配置MySQL,则遇到无法启动的问题,可能是由于配...

9
DbVisualizer添加MySQL数... 如何在DbVisualizer中添加本地mysql数据库由于DbVisualiz...

10
SQL字段默认值设置全攻略:轻松实现自动... sql如何设置字段默认值设置SQL中某个字段的默认值;需要遵循几个步骤。首先您需...